Specifications for the preparation of publication supply and marketing agreements

1 Scope

This standard specifies the basic requirements for the preparation of publication supply and marketing agreements, the basic elements of composition, common types, and the compilation process and requirements. This standard applies to the preparation of publication supply and marketing agreements.

2 Normative references

The following documents are essential for the application of this document. For dated references, only the dated version applies to this document. For undated references, the latest version (including all amendments) applies to this document. GB/T 27936-2012 Publication Terminology

3 terms and definitions

The following terms and definitions apply to this document. 3.1 Agreement Contract Agreement on the establishment, change, and termination of civil rights and obligations between natural persons, legal persons, and other organizations with equal subject. [Contract Law of the People's Republic of China] 3.2 Supply and marketing The act of supplying and selling in a publication trading activity. 3.3 Ordering The buyer orders the publication from the seller. [GB/T 27936-2011, definition 6.18] 3.4 Delivery Form shipping instructions, manufacturing orders, picking, collection, review, packaging, and shipment according to the publication order until the publication is delivered for collection Cargo process. [GB/T 27936-2011, definition 7.26] 3.5 Receiving The process of checking and accepting the delivered publications and going to the warehouse. [GB/T 27936-2011, definition 7.16] 3.6 Checking and acceptance The process of inspecting and verifying the variety, quantity, quality, and packaging of publications, and confirming them according to the receipt receipt [GB/T 27936-2011, definition 7.17] 3.7 Return The process by which a buyer returns a publication to a seller. [GB/T 27936-2011, definition 7.48] 3.8 Settlement settlement In publication trading activities, the payment and payment behavior of both parties to the transaction. [GB/T 27936-2011, definition 9.22] 3.9 Terminal user The target of the publishing unit to sell publications includes individuals, institutions or legal entities with civil capacity.

4 Basic requirements for protocol preparation

The basic requirements include. a) shall comply with the relevant laws, regulations and provisions of the press and publishing industry of the People's Republic of China; b) the principles of equality, mutual benefit, consensus, etc. should be followed; c) the subject of the agreement shall have relevant qualifications; d) other.

5 Basic elements of the agreement

5.1 About the first part The first part of the agreement mainly includes. a) the agreement name and agreement number; b) the legal name, telephone and legal address of the subject of the agreement; c) Preamble to the agreement. 5.2 Body The body part mainly includes. a) Cooperation content and methods, including sales categories, supply and marketing methods, cooperation periods, sales areas, discounts and other content; b) Basic elements of the main body of the paper supply and marketing agreement. 1) Order, including order content, order method, order cancellation content and other contents; 2) Shipping, including shipping method, shipping address, shipping cost and other contents; 3) Receiving and acceptance, including receiving method, acceptance process, acceptance difference processing method and other contents; 4) Returns, including the contents of the return, the time limit for the return, the amount of the return, the processing method of the return difference, the return cost and other contents; 5) Recall and exchange; 6) Settlement, including settlement period, settlement conditions, payment account number, invoice and other contents; 7) Services, including training, marketing and other content. c) Basic elements of the main body of the digital publishing product supply and marketing agreement. 1) The form and scope of the platform or product release; 2) Order of platform or product, including order content, order cancellation content and others; 3) Download, installation or activation of the platform or product; 4) Acceptance, including the acceptance process, acceptance issues, and other content; 5) Settlement, including settlement period, settlement conditions, payment account number, invoice and other contents; 6) Operation and maintenance and background management of the platform or product. d) force majeure; e) liability for breach of contract; f) confidentiality and intellectual property protection; g) other. 5.3 Approx. Tail 5.3.1 Validity of the agreement The validity of the agreement mainly includes. a) the agreement becomes effective, renewed and terminated; b) the number and form of the agreements; c) Dispute resolution. 5.3.2 Signature of Agreement The signature of the agreement mainly includes. a) Signature of legal person; b) Signature of legal representative or authorized representative; a) the date of the contract; b) Place of contract. 5.4 Supplement The supplementary part mainly includes. a) the serial number and name of the annex to the agreement; b) financial information, which should include the information provided during payment and invoicing; c) other.

6 Common types of protocols

Common types of protocols include. a) The publication supply and marketing agreement between the publishing unit and the issuing unit. See Appendix A for a sample agreement; b) Publication supply and marketing agreements between distribution units, see Appendix B for sample agreements; c) The publication supply and marketing agreement between the issuing unit and the end user, see Appendix C for a sample agreement; d) other.

7 Preparation process and requirements of the agreement

7.1 Preparation of the agreement The preparation of the agreement mainly includes. a) Verification of contractual eligibility and performance capability of the parties; b) Feasibility study. 7.2 Drafting of the agreement The drafting of the agreement mainly includes. a) negotiation of agreements; b) The drafting of the agreement shall be the responsibility of the negotiator or negotiating team of the host department, and may be drafted and revised by a lawyer based on the negotiating points if necessary. positive. The target should be clear, equal and mutually beneficial, complete in content, complete in terms of terms, clear in responsibilities, and adequate risk control. 7.3 Risk review of the agreement Risk reviews should be performed by legal professionals or relevant authorities. 7.4 Signing of the agreement The agreement shall be signed by a person with signing authority, and the official seal or special seal of the agreement shall be affixed. 7.5 Protocol text management Protocol text management mainly includes. a) archived by authorized departments for inspection; b) Binding into a book and implementing archive management; c) After the agreement is performed, it is generally kept for more than 10 years, which is consistent with the financial management regulations of the unit.
